Output 96390260cf0d41ef9886ad8e3b7943b14b83035e310b7ed3b47fbb21b4423794:0

value
83361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e18f7acbdadf43494a38383c25bad2be61a4f48 OP_EQUAL
address
38oxYH3VXPS7swHYZ1NGWWWnjwnyB43Kur
transaction
96390260cf0d41ef9886ad8e3b7943b14b83035e310b7ed3b47fbb21b4423794
spent
true